ANTH 315 Course Description

Title: Peoples and Cultures of Central America
GE Status:
U.S. History and Government:
Prerequisites: junior standing or consent of instructor.
Term(s) Offered:
Units: (3)
Description: Historical perspective on Central America from pre-conquest period to today, focusing on the indigenous cultures of the region. Examines contemporary cultural, political and economic conflicts, including the current revolutionary conflicts and the area's relationship to the U.S.
Effective: Spring 1989
Latest Offering: Summer 2007
